I keep hearing conflicting views on the Pac/MAB fight, but from what I hear from a lot of writers and most casual fans is that the fight was good, but Barrera kept running, trying not to get KO'd, while Manny was trying to bring the fight. But you know, every once in a while, you will get a not-so-exciting Pacquiao fight, so this was probably it.

I actually watched the Peter/McCline fight (as I had no one to watch the PPV with and I didn't want to pay all that money), and that was a good fight. I have to disagree with dork though, Peter clearly won that fight. McCline won 2, maybe 3 rounds, it just so happened he scored his 3 knockdowns within 2 rounds. Peter didn't look his best, but you have to remember that McCline wasn't exactly a "10-day notice fighter"; he had already been training to fight Vitali Klitschko before Vitali pulled out. McCline was in shape. Peter hadn't fought since January. Still, that was fairly shocking to me, but don't everybody go saying that all of a sudden Maskaev beats Peter based on one fight. Everybody has an off-night, and I myself was rather impressed with Peter's heart and resilience. He picked himself off the canvas and outhustled McCline to win that fight, not unlike the way Pavlik survived a KO scare against Taylor to eventually win the fight by KO himself. Peter is still a big favorite against Maskaev.
